		<description>Hi, Chimaobi. I&#039;m from Iceland, &quot;Feces&quot; means &quot;Saur&quot; in Icelandic, I don&#039;t know of any words that describe black people here that even resemble that word, the closest would be &quot;Surtur&quot;, which is usually thought of as derogatory term here (To the point of actually being on the same level as &quot;nigger&quot; in English), so its hardly ever used. An interesting side-note: Surtur is a fire jotun in the Norse mythologies.

However, Icelandic people generally call black people just &quot;black&quot;, (svartur/svertingi), white people are white (hvÃ­tur/hvÃ­tingi), there are no fancy/high culture words for races here, it just is what it is, the idea behind that is not really a racist one, its just that people here are mostly (not the older generation) indifferent to this stuff, because this shit just don&#039;t matter here, which is in my opinion the best route to take, people are judged by their personalities and their traits, not by some superficial idea that has no real impact in the world.</description>
